## Blueprint transport — Alderbeck permit set

Stamped blueprints for the Alderbeck building permit travel in sealed tubes only. Coordinator assigns one driver per run; no shared loads with site materials. Tubes ride in the cab, upright, never the cargo bay. Driver signs the transit log at pick-up and delivery. No photocopies en route. The courier hand-over instruction is given on the line directly below.

courier memo of yahif-faweg: the quenael tamius courier leaves the prawyn jorix kaswyn istox silmir brieth zormir fenvan ledger at gate 3145 under passcode 231062

## Deployment

Liftplan Simulator runs as two services: the dispatch engine and the scenario player. Support staff deploying a customer sandbox should pull the latest stable tag and start the scenario player first; the engine refuses connections until a scenario manifest is loaded. Sandboxes at Orvette Tower scale are fine on a single node. Logs rotate daily and are safe to delete after a week. When standing up a new sandbox, apply the configuration values listed below before starting the engine.

deployment values, kahof-yadug:
[gorys]
team = silael
access_code = ac_00d620
owner = istox.oliys
host = gorys.torvastack.example
port = 9000
peer = holmir.merlaqsoft.example
salt = 9fdae78a
pin = 2358

Hey — before you size the Pondrel websocket fleet, remember compression isn't free. Per-message deflate saves us bandwidth on the chatty dashboards but chews CPU and memory per connection, so we cap window sizes and skip small frames. Getting these knobs wrong is how the Trelling outage happened. The current tradeoff settings are defined as follows.

tuning table, yajog-yahof:
BUDGETS = {
    "lamvan": 303,
    "wenox": 460,
    "fenvan": 525,
}